Angular 财产';项目节点';不存在于类型';渲染器2';
我正在将我的Angular项目从Angular 4迁移到Angular 8。目前,我正在将渲染器更新为Renderer2。我有一个代码片段Angular 财产';项目节点';不存在于类型';渲染器2';,angular,angular2-template,angular2-services,angular2-directives,Angular,Angular2 Template,Angular2 Services,Angular2 Directives,我正在将我的Angular项目从Angular 4迁移到Angular 8。目前,我正在将渲染器更新为Renderer2。我有一个代码片段 this._renderer.projectNodes(document.body, [this._element.nativeElement, this.backdrop.instance.element.nativeElement]); 我试图找到projectNodes方法对DOM的实际作用,但是我找不到关于这个方法的更多细节。有人能详细说明proj
this._renderer.projectNodes(document.body, [this._element.nativeElement, this.backdrop.instance.element.nativeElement]);
我试图找到projectNodes方法对DOM的实际作用,但是我找不到关于这个方法的更多细节。有人能详细说明projectNodes的功能以及如何将此代码升级到Render2吗?正如我正确理解的那样,此函数只是将子元素附加到元素(主体)中,您可以查看此处 这里呢 因此,我认为您可以用两行
render2.appendChild